Summary
Thordata offers proxy infrastructure solutions (residential, mobile, and data center proxies) to help AI teams and data-driven businesses collect high-quality web data for AI training and applications. The service focuses on enabling reliable global data collection, responsible regional access, and scalable data pipelines with an emphasis on performance, stability, and compliance.
